Discover Millville, MAMillville, MA is a small New England town on the Rhode Island border in Worcester County, known for its Blackstone River Valley heritage. History and HeritageIncorporated in 1916 after separating from Blackstone, the town grew around water-powered mills and the historic Blackstone Canal. You can explore the well-preserved Millville Lock, a key site within the Blackstone River Valley National Historical Park and Heritage Corridor. Charming mill-era architecture and stonework lend the village center an authentic, walkable character. Outdoor RecreationThe Southern New England Trunkline Trail (SNETT) runs through town, making it one of the top things to do in Millville, MA for year-round biking, walking, and snowshoeing. Local parks, river vistas, and wooded conservation areas make it easy to enjoy nature close to home. Living in MillvilleMillville, MA is part of the Blackstone-Millville Regional School District and provides a small-town lifestyle with convenient access to nearby job centers. Housing options range from historic farmhouses to newer single-family homes, appealing to buyers seeking value in the Blackstone Valley real estate market. Community events, youth sports, and nearby shopping and dining in neighboring towns round out the everyday amenities.
